Resident Geotechnical Engineer BID SYSTRA, a global leader in engineering and consulting for public transport and mobility solutions, is currently bidding for Urban Planning projects across India. We are seeking a highly experienced Resident Geotechnical Engineer to be a key part of these bids. With over 65 years of expertise and a strong presence in India since 1957, SYSTRA is dedicated to delivering reliable, cost-effective, and tailored solutions for efficient transportation and urban infrastructure. Our comprehensive know-how spans the entire spectrum of mass rapid transit systems, including railways, metros, roads, buildings, and water & environment infrastructure. Our expertise covers all project stages, from upstream studies to operation and maintenance, offering services as Detailed Design Consultants, Project Management, and Independent Checking. Missions/Main Duties As a Resident Geotechnical Engineer for these bids, your responsibilities will include: Analyzing soil and rock samples to determine their properties, such as strength, permeability, and composition. Developing factual and interpretive ground models based on the collected data. Developing plans for foundations, retaining walls, and other geotechnical elements. Evaluating the stability of slopes and recommending solutions for potential landslides or other slope failures. Considering the environmental impact of construction projects and recommending measures to mitigate risk. Collaborating with architects, engineers, and contractors to understand project requirements and provide geotechnical expertise. Creating technical reports, drawings, and specifications to communicate findings and recommendations. Monitoring construction activities to ensure that geotechnical recommendations are followed and that the project is proceeding safely and effectively. Ensuring that all construction activities are conducted in a safe and responsible manner. Reviewing the design prepared in the Detailed Design phase and preparing Construction Drawings to issue to the Contractor. Examining the sub-soil investigation reports, shop drawings, work plan/schedule, quality assurance plan, and methodology submitted by the Contractor, and if found acceptable, recommending it for approval. Profile/Skills Education: Graduation in Civil Engineering or equivalent relevant degree. Experience: 20 years of general/professional experience. Generally 15 years of similar experience in the field of Geotech / foundation / underground / soil investigation. Minimum 5 years experience as a Geotechnical Engineer/Foundation Engineer . Working experience in the SAARC/ASEAN region would be preferable. Ability to work in both an independent and team-oriented, collaborative environment. Strong team player, capable of conforming to shifting priorities, demands, and timelines through patience, analytical, and problem-solving capabilities. Ability to understand communication styles of team members and clients from a broad spectrum of disciplines.
